If you're looking for a delightful outdoor activity near Capo di Feno, a 2-3 hour walking tour is the perfect way to immerse yourself in the natural beauty and rich history of the area. Located in Corsica, France, Capo di Feno is renowned for its stunning coastline, rugged landscapes, and picturesque trails. One of the most popular walking routes is the Sentier des Douaniers, also known as the Customs Path. This scenic trail stretches along the coast, offering breathtaking views of the turquoise Mediterranean Sea and the rugged cliffs that characterize this part of the island. As you meander along the path, you'll encounter charming coves, hidden beaches, and impressive rock formations, making it an ideal spot for nature lovers and photographers alike. The walking tour will also take you through the fragrant maquis, the Mediterranean scrubland that covers Corsica's hillsides. Here, you'll have the chance to admire the island's unique flora and fauna, including aromatic herbs, colorful wildflowers, and perhaps even spot some Corsican wildlife like wild boars or birds of prey. As you delve deeper into the countryside, you'll stumble upon ancient ruins and historic landmarks that tell the story of Corsica's past. From ancient watchtowers to abandoned shepherd huts, each site holds its own secrets and adds a touch of mystery to your journey. Throughout the tour, you'll have plenty of opportunities to take breaks, savor the breathtaking views, and even enjoy a picnic amidst the idyllic surroundings. Capo di Feno Beach is a stunning sandy beach located in Corsica, France, near the GPS coordinates 41.9721, 8.7647. This beautiful beach is known for its clear waters and picturesque surroundings.

Description:

Capo di Feno Beach is a long stretch of sandy shoreline that offers a tranquil and relaxing atmosphere. The beach is backed by dunes and surrounded by rocky cliffs, creating a scenic and idyllic setting. The crystal-clear waters of the Mediterranean Sea make it a perfect spot for swimming and snorkeling. The beach is relatively secluded and less crowded compared to other popular beaches in Corsica. It is a great place to unwind, soak up the sun, and enjoy the natural beauty of the surroundings.

History:

Capo di Feno Beach holds historical significance as it is located near the Pointe de la Parata, a historical site that was once fortified to protect the Gulf of Ajaccio. The area has seen various military activities and was an important strategic point during World War II. The coastal trail towards Pointe de la Parata offers not only scenic views but also a glimpse into the historical past of the region. Exploring this trail will allow visitors to appreciate the natural beauty of the coastline while learning about its historical significance. ◍The Tour de la Parata and Sentier des Crêtes are located near the GPS coordinates 42.0001, 8.7535 in Corsica, France. Tour de la Parata: The Tour de la Parata is a historic Genoese tower that was built in the 16th century. It is situated on a rocky promontory overlooking the Gulf of Ajaccio and offers panoramic views of the surrounding area. The tower was constructed as part of a defensive network to protect the coastline from pirate attacks. The tower is made of local stone and stands at a height of about 11 meters. It has a cylindrical shape with a conical roof and is surrounded by a small fortified wall. Inside, there are several levels that were used for observation and defense. Today, the Tour de la Parata is a popular tourist attraction. Visitors can explore the tower and learn about its history through informational panels. The panoramic views from the top of the tower are breathtaking, offering a stunning vista of the Gulf of Ajaccio and the Sanguinaires Islands. Sentier des Crêtes: The Sentier des Crêtes is a trail that follows the rugged cliffs along the coast towards the Sanguinaires Islands. It offers hikers stunning views of the turquoise waters of the Mediterranean Sea and the rocky coastline of Corsica. The trail starts near the Tour de la Parata and extends for approximately 5 kilometers. It takes about 45 minutes to walk, depending on the pace and stops along the way. The path is well-marked and relatively easy to navigate, but it does involve some steep and rocky sections. As you hike along the Sentier des Crêtes, you'll be treated to panoramic vistas of the coastline and the Sanguinaires Islands. These islands are a small archipelago known for their red granite rock formations and rich marine life. The area is also home to a variety of bird species, including seagulls and cormorants.
